KETTLEDRUM

n.

2 definitions — Webster’s Dictionary (1828)


1.
n.

A drum made of thin copper in the form of a hemispherical kettle, with parchment stretched over the mouth of it.

2.
n.

An informal social party at which a light collation is offered, held in the afternoon or early evening. Cf. Drum, n., 4 and 5.
